Abstract
In this paper, we apply the energy variational principle to arrive at the differential equation of motion and all appropriate boundary conditions for strain gradient Kirchhoff micro‐plates. The resulting sixth‐order boundary value problem of free vibration is solved by a thirty‐six‐DOF four‐node differential quadrature plate finite element.
